Shock-absorbing material for labor insurance shoes

   Labor insurance shoes need to pay special attention to the wearing comfort of workers. Different shock absorption materials can be used to achieve different shock absorption effects:

 

1. EVA is currently the most widely used shock absorbing material for the production of labor insurance shoes, mainly used in the midsole. The main components are vinyl acetate vinegar, ethylene n-butyl acrylate polymer, etc., and form an elastomer after foaming. Adjusting the blowing agent gives products with different hardness and elasticity. The filler is generally titanium white powder, zinc oxide, calcium carbonate, etc., and the excessive amount causes a large compression set and a small elasticity. Adding PE can increase the tension and tearing force, but the elasticity is poor and it is easy to stick to the control.

 

2, PU polyurethane can be used for the midsole and outsole of labor insurance shoes. The reason why polyurethane is used is because it has good wear resistance, good elasticity and light weight. Poor pull after foaming, resistant to aging.

 

3, rubber is mainly used in the outsole of labor insurance shoes, the reason why the choice of rubber for shock absorption materials, mainly because of the good elasticity of foam rubber, is a special shock-absorbing rubber. In general-purpose rubber, butyl rubber and nitrile rubber have a large damping coefficient; styrene-butadiene rubber, neoprene, silicone rubber, urethane rubber, and ethylene-propylene rubber have moderate damping coefficients; natural rubber and butadiene rubber have the lowest damping coefficient. Although the natural rubber has the smallest damping coefficient, it has good comprehensive performance, good fatigue resistance, low heat generation, small creep and good adhesion to metals. Therefore, natural rubber is widely used in shock absorbing rubber. If it is required to withstand low temperature, it can be used together with cis-butadiene rubber; when it is required to resist aging, it can be used together with chloroprene rubber; when oil resistance is required, it can be used together with butyl rubber with low acrylonitrile content, and it is required for low temperature dynamic performance. , often using silicone rubber. Natural rubber is generally required for low damping; butyl rubber can be used when high damping is required. Some rubbers with good heat resistance, such as fluororubber, acrylate rubber, EPDM rubber, silicone rubber, hydrogenated nitrile rubber, chlorosulfonated polyethylene, copolychlorohydrin rubber, due to their high deformation Fatigue resistance and reliability with metal bonding are poor, so it is not suitable for shock absorbing rubber.
